Mode Select by buffer zone of polyline

Purpose and description

This mode permits selecting all features for which the distance to the specified polyline does not exceed the set value called buffer zone width. The system opens an auxiliary window “Selection polyline”.

To specify selection polyline it is necessary to move the cursor by polyline vertices clicking on every vertex. It is possible to undo incorrect creation of a vertex by performing the command Rollback from the context menu. Building a polyline is completed after a double click in the last vertex.

Buffer zone width is determined on page “Parameters” of the property sheet of the browsed theme.

To determine selected features the set selection threshold is used.

Additional possibilities of performing selection and deselection of features are connected with using the keys Ctrl, Alt, Shift.

Calling methods

The button of the mode toolbar in map browser window.
